Samantha Perez‐Miller is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Samantha Perez‐Miller has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Molecular Biology, 18 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 12 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Samantha Perez‐Miller’s work include Axon Guidance and Neuronal Signaling (11 papers), Pain Mechanisms and Treatments (10 papers) and Ion channel regulation and function (10 papers). Samantha Perez‐Miller is often cited by papers focused on Axon Guidance and Neuronal Signaling (11 papers), Pain Mechanisms and Treatments (10 papers) and Ion channel regulation and function (10 papers). Samantha Perez‐Miller collaborates with scholars based in United States, China and South Korea. Samantha Perez‐Miller's co-authors include Thomas D. Hurley, May Khanna, Rajesh Khanna, Liberty François‐Moutal, Aubin Moutal, Daria Mochly‐Rosen, Ram Vanam, Hina Younus, Che-Hong Chen and Kimberly Gómez and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Applied Physics Letters.
